WebFeb 22, 2024 · Time and a half hourly rate = standard hourly rate x 1.5. The steps are as follows: Start with the employee’s usual hourly rate. Calculate the overtime rate using the formula above. Multiply the overtime hours worked by the overtime rate (time and a half) Add the overtime pay to the standard wage amount. Here’s an example with these steps. Time and a half … WebTo calculate hourly overtime rate, multiply normal rate of pay by the company’s overtime rate. To find total overtime wages, simply multiply the amount of overtime hours worked by the calculated rate of overtime. $10 hourly wage becomes $15 ($10 x 1.5), with time and a half pay. An 8-hour day yields $120 (8 hours x $15).
